  • Patent number: 8035956
    Abstract: A Line Replaceable Unit (LRU) support system incorporates a unitary tray having a rear boss and an integral Air Cooling System (ACS) plenum and an ACS conduit through the rear boss communicating with the plenum. A tray support and alignment element provides a flange with tray attachment studs extending from a front surface, wall attachment studs extending from a rear surface, and an ACS aperture. The wall attachment studs are received in spaced holes in a mounting structure and the tray attachment studs are received in bores in the rear boss of the tray. Insertion of the tray attachment studs aligns the ACS conduit in the rear boss and the ACS aperture in the flange. A backing plate engages the wall attachment studs to secure the tray support and alignment element to the mounting structure. The backing plate includes an ACS spud aligned with the ACS aperture.
